Some background: This sketch was penciled and inked by Arthur Adams. It is in mint condition measuring approximately 6.75" x 10.75" on strathmore paper. Arthur has signed and dated it toward the bottom. There is some residual blue line from the underlying structural sketch. Art area represents about 99.5% of the measurements.
